Last month, Van Heck was able to contribute to an artificial island in the Bay of Szczecin in northern Poland, near the German border.
It’s a ring-shaped island. The inside of the ring serves as a basin for the dredged material, causing the water level to rise.

 VAN HECK’S CONTRIBUTION

The requirement was to supply 2 pumps to pump the water out of the inside of the ring. During dredging these pumps had to keep the water level at the same level as outside of the dike.
Two DPP300-PHK500 pumps went from Noordwolde to Poland for this job. Together these pumps are good for 9000 m³/h.
